Abstract
Abstract The behavior of ethyl 2-phenylthiocarb-amoyl acetate 1 toward a variety of several α-halo-carbonyl compounds was investigated. Thus, reaction of 1 with α-bromoketones, hydrazonoyl bromides, and 2-chloro-N-arylacetamides afforded the corresponding dihydrothiazole, 1, 3, 4-thiadiazole, and thiophene derivatives, respectively.
